Output 8b69eb6078e02fe22e75994986625d68656c40700b1eea4341bccd7703093634:44

value
184908
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e58484f18b54300f2a429bb7078a6613c61c9ecf OP_EQUALVERIFY OP_CHECKSIG
address
1MvaVXsdWgTwQJvVvPtotmrT3vaSdWWQQU
transaction
8b69eb6078e02fe22e75994986625d68656c40700b1eea4341bccd7703093634
spent
true